Two school girls killed in tipper collision



KATHMANDU: Two school girls were killed when a tipper knocked them down at Melamchichowk of Sundarijal in Gokarneshwor municipality in Kathmandu this morning.

The deceased have been identified as Shristi Ghising and Shreeya Ghising, daughters of Rohan Ghising.
According to Police Circle, Bouddha, the accident took place when a tipper (Ba 4 Cha 6965) collided with the motorcycle carrying rider Ghising and his two daughters.

The girls who were on the way to their school in the locality died on the spot in the accident occurred at around 8:30 am, police said. Rider Ghising, who is critically hurt in the accident, is being treated in the Nepal Medical College at Attarkhel.

Injured rider Ghising accused the tipper driver of putting the vehicle in back gear and running over his daughters.
